reinforced thermosetting resin

简明释义

增强热固树脂

英英释义

A type of composite material made from thermosetting resins that have been reinforced with fibers or other materials to enhance strength and durability.

In modern manufacturing and construction, materials play a crucial role in determining the durability and performance of products. One such material that has gained significant attention is reinforced thermosetting resin. This composite material combines the strength of reinforcement fibers with the unique properties of thermosetting resins, resulting in a versatile and robust solution for various applications. Understanding the characteristics and advantages of reinforced thermosetting resin can help industries make informed choices about their material selections.Firstly, it is essential to define what reinforced thermosetting resin is. Thermosetting resins are polymers that undergo a chemical change when heated, leading to a rigid structure that cannot be remolded. When these resins are reinforced with materials such as glass or carbon fibers, they exhibit enhanced mechanical properties. The reinforcement provides additional strength, stiffness, and resistance to impact, making reinforced thermosetting resin an ideal choice for demanding environments.The applications of reinforced thermosetting resin are vast and varied. In the automotive industry, for example, components made from this material can withstand harsh conditions while maintaining structural integrity. Similarly, in the aerospace sector, the lightweight yet strong nature of reinforced thermosetting resin contributes to fuel efficiency and overall performance of aircraft. Furthermore, in the construction industry, this material is used in producing panels, beams, and other structural elements that require high durability and resistance to environmental factors.One of the most significant advantages of reinforced thermosetting resin is its excellent thermal stability. Unlike thermoplastics, which can melt and reshape under heat, thermosetting resins retain their shape and strength even at elevated temperatures. This property makes them suitable for applications that involve exposure to heat, such as electrical insulations and automotive parts subjected to engine temperatures.Moreover, reinforced thermosetting resin offers superior chemical resistance compared to other materials. This attribute is particularly beneficial in industries where exposure to corrosive substances is common, such as in chemical processing plants. The ability to resist degradation ensures that products made from this material have a longer lifespan, reducing the need for frequent replacements and maintenance.Additionally, the versatility of reinforced thermosetting resin allows for customization in terms of formulation and processing techniques. Manufacturers can tailor the resin's properties by selecting different types of reinforcing fibers and additives, enabling the production of materials that meet specific performance requirements. This adaptability is crucial in an era where industries are increasingly focused on innovation and sustainability.Despite its numerous advantages, there are some challenges associated with reinforced thermosetting resin. The curing process can be time-consuming and may require precise temperature control to ensure optimal performance. Additionally, once cured, the material cannot be reshaped, which limits its reusability compared to thermoplastics. However, ongoing research and advancements in technology are addressing these issues, making reinforced thermosetting resin more accessible and efficient for manufacturers.In conclusion, reinforced thermosetting resin represents a significant advancement in material science, offering a combination of strength, durability, and versatility.
